Fitment Information
- Toyota 4Runner (2003, 2004, 2005, 2006, 2007, 2008, 2009)
Tech Info
- Standard Travel:
- Factory Wheels & Tires Fitment: Yes
- Recommended Aftermarket Wheels: 8.5″ wide wheel with 4.75″ backspace
- Recommended Aftermarket Tires: 33″ x 11.50″ (Larger Tires May Fit but Fender Trimming and Modifications will be Required)
- Extended Travel:
- Factory Wheels & Tires Fitment: Yes
- Recommended Aftermarket Wheels: ICON Alloys | 17×8.5 w/ 4.75″ Backspace / 0mm Offset
- Recommended Aftermarket Wheels: ICON Alloys | 18×9 w/ 5″ Backspace / 0mm Offset
- Recommended Aftermarket Tires: 33″ x 11.50″ (Larger Tires May Fit but Fender Trimming and Modifications will be Required)
- TECH NOTE: Aftermarket front upper control arms required for installation
- TECH NOTE: 700lb/in spring rate only recommended for trucks with additional weight added to front end. See ICON Help Center for information.

Description
The ICON Vehicle Dynamics V.S. 2.5 Series remote reservoir coilover shocks are an incredible upgrade for the front end of the Toyota FJ Cruiser, 4Runner, and Lexus GX platforms. ICON’s Vehicle-specific valving provides a sport tuned feel on and off-road while offering 0-3.5” of lift height adjustability for use of larger, more aggressive wheel and tire combinations. ICON’s larger 2.5” shock body and increased piston area over stock components provides improved damping ability and outstanding ride characteristics across varying types of terrain. Remote reservoirs ensure optimum performance by increasing the duration of consistent damping regardless of situation, keeping the shocks at a cooler operating temperature during heavy use. These extended length versions offer increased wheel travel but also require the installation of aftermarket upper control arms in conjunction with the coilovers.
When paired with ICON 2.0 Aluminum Series or 2.5 Series rear shocks, vehicle control will be balanced front to rear resulting in the best overall driving experience for your Toyota or Lexus SUV.
